About the role:

We are currently seeking a dedicated and experienced SEN Teaching Assistant with a specialism in Social, Emotional, and Mental Health (SEMH) needs to join our team in Brent, London. The successful candidate will work closely with children in Key Stage 1 and Key Stage 2 who require additional support due to their SEMH needs.

Application Requirements:

• Experience working with children with SEMH needs in a school or similar setting

.• Strong understanding of SEMH and its impact on learning and behavior

.•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to build positive relationships with students, colleagues, and parents

.• Commitment to promoting inclusion, diversity, and equality in education

.• Ability to adapt to the diverse needs of students and work effectively as part of a multidisciplinary team.

Key Responsibilities:

• Provide one-on-one and small group support to students with SEMH needs, both in the classroom and in specialised support settings

.• Implement individualised education plans (IEPs) and behavior management strategies to support students' learning and social development.

• Collaborate with teachers, parents, and other professionals to create a supportive and inclusive learning environment for students with SEMH needs.
